Transaction 25bebf5937715e93f5b5daa23820cb1952a4e723b0892fccfb47e8528985581e
1 Input
1 Output
-
25bebf5937715e93f5b5daa23820cb1952a4e723b0892fccfb47e8528985581e:0
- value
- 2366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90c590a00deb9d68379a26decb6d88d379aa756e OP_EQUAL
- address
- 3EtVuDiutquWfpwYgjpX13Wm8EUwM2jeV7